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chat bai | Leschenault's rousette |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mammifères) | Mammalia (mammifères) |
| Order | Carnivora (carnivores)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Felidae (Cats) | Pteropodidae (Fruit Bats) |
| Genus | Catopuma | Rousettus |
| Species | Catopuma badia | Rousettus leschenaultii |
Evolutionary Relationship
Chat bai and Leschenault's rousette share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mammifères)
